2SC1213AKD Transistor Specification

Transistor Code 2SC1213AKD
Transistor Type BJT
Transistor Polarity NPN
Transistor Material Silicon(SI)
Package TO92
Collector Power Dissipation (Maximum) PC 0.4W
Collector-Base Voltage (Maximum) VCB 50V
Collector-Emitter Voltage (Maximum) VCE 50V
Collector Current (Maximum) IC 0.5A
Operating Junction Temperature (Maximum) TJ 150°C
Emitter-Base Voltage (Maximum) VEB 4V
Forward Current Transfer Ratio (hFE Value) 160
Transition Frequency FT 120MHz
Collector Capacitance CC 7pF
